Job Search and Career Advice Platform

Enable job alerts via email!

Managing Partner - Performance Lead

Sphere Digital Recruitment

Greater London

Hybrid

GBP 100,000 - 120,000

Full time

Yesterday
Be an early applicant

Generate a tailored resume in minutes

Land an interview and earn more. Learn more

Job summary

A leading recruitment agency is seeking a Senior Performance Lead to take ownership of a large, complex performance hub for a major global consumer brand. This hybrid role involves driving performance strategies across markets, leading executive-level client relationships, and mentoring senior teams. The ideal candidate will possess extensive experience in performance marketing, strong leadership skills, and the ability to influence stakeholders at the highest levels. Competitive pro-rata salary ranging from £100,000 to £120,000.

Qualifications

  • Extensive experience in performance marketing leadership, particularly in complex environments.
  • Ability to influence executive-level stakeholders effectively.
  • Experience in managing large teams across multiple markets.

Responsibilities

  • Define and drive the overall performance vision.
  • Lead and develop senior performance leaders within the hub.
  • Set and own the performance strategy across markets.

Skills

Performance strategy development
Leadership
Media buying practices
Cross-channel integration
Client stakeholder management
Job description
Senior Performance Lead

Agency | EMEA & North America | London (Hybrid)

We're looking for a senior performance leader to take ownership of a large, complex, multi-market performance hub for a major global consumer brand. This is a high-profile role within an agency environment, sitting at the intersection of strategy, leadership and transformation.

You'll be the most senior performance authority on the account, responsible for setting direction across paid media disciplines and leading a sizeable, geographically distributed team across Europe and North America.

The Role

As Senior Performance Lead, you will define and drive the overall performance vision, ensuring excellence, consistency and innovation across all markets. You'll partner closely with a highly experienced and demanding client team, acting as a trusted advisor while pushing the agenda forward.

Key responsibilities include:

  • Setting and owning the performance strategy and long-term vision across markets
  • Acting as the senior point of contact for executive-level client stakeholders
  • Leading and developing senior performance leaders within the hub
  • Driving cohesion and alignment across a large, multi-market operation
  • Championing and delivering major transformation and modernisation initiatives
  • Ensuring best-in-class media buying practices and strong cross-channel integration
  • Holding teams accountable to agreed digital and performance commitments
Channels

The role has a strong emphasis on Social and Programmatic, with Search included as part of the broader performance mix.

Team & Environment
  • Around 30 onshore and 20 offshore specialists
  • Approximately 100 people across the wider hub (planning, strategy, operations)
  • Member of the senior Digital Leadership Team alongside Heads of, Partners and Leads
Contract & Compensation
  • Maternity cover, starting mid-late January
  • Pro-rata salary: £100,000-£120,000
  • Day-rate equivalent of approximately £385-£462, depending on level
Working Pattern
  • Hybrid: 3 days per week in the London office
  • Core in-office days: Monday and Wednesday
  • Occasional travel to Europe for senior stakeholder meetings
Who This Suits

This role is ideal for a seasoned performance leader who thrives in complex, matrixed environments, is comfortable influencing at the highest level, and enjoys shaping large-scale transformation across multiple markets.

Sphere Digital Recruitment is acting as an Employment Business in relation to this vacancy.

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.